BRASHEARS v. COM.

No. 95-CA-0969-MR.

944 S.W.2d 873 (1997)

Charles B. BRASHEARS, Appellant, v. COMMONWEALTH of Kentucky, CABINET FOR HUMAN RESOURCES, and Tonya Spencer, Appellees.

Court of Appeals of Kentucky.

May 2, 1997.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Cynthia E. Elliott, Appalacian Research and Defense Fund of Ky., Inc., Jackson, for appellant.

Billy L. Oliver, Campton, for appellees.

Before DYCHE, GARDNER and KNOPF, JJ.


KNOPF, Judge.

The Cabinet for Human Resources (Cabinet) has been empowered by legislation to recover child support obligations particularly for children who receive Aid to Families with Dependent Children (AFDC). See, KRS 205.710 et. seq. In 1995 the Cabinet filed a motion to set child support against Charles Brashear for his daughter, Erica.
